Job Summary Under the general direction of the University Open Computer Lab Coordinator and working in a team environment, the University Open Computer Lab Assistant provides assistance to students and escalates technical issues, as appropriate. Tracks the usage and maintenance of computers, printers, and equipment within the University Horn Center Computer Lab.

Benefits

  • Generous Paid Time Off : Up to 24 vacation days per year (based on employee group and/or service), 14 paid holidays, and 12 sick days annually with unlimited accrual.
  • Comprehensive Health Coverage : A variety of medical, dental, and vision plans to suit your needs.
  • Retirement Plans : Participation in CalPERS defined benefit plan and access to voluntary savings plans like 403(b), 401(k), and 457.
  • Educational Benefits : Tuition fee waivers for employees and eligible dependents.
  • Employee Assistance Program (EAP) : Confidential counseling and support services for employees and their families.
  • Additional Perks : Access to wellness programs, professional development opportunities, and various insurance options including life, disability, and pet insurance.
